2023 monthly color challenge – the finished quilt

The 2023 Monthly Color Challenge is now complete. This event was hosted by Patterns by Jen. Look for the 2024 Monthly Color Challenge starting this month.

the challenge

The 2023 Monthly Color Challenge was the 6th year. The inspiration was Classic Cars.

Each month a block was released and we made the block using the colour for that month.

The quilt

My scrap stash was full and so I used the ones I had enough of for each month. I decided to alternate the backgrounds for each month. The sashings were also alternated to play across the quilt and use up some of the strips I had cut for the quilt.

When it came to the border I used many of the fabrics that had enough left to cut squares from, I did hope that I had enough without needing more fabric. The remaining lengths were then used in the binding after quilting. I now have only 3 of these fabrics with a useable rectangle left over, which is so good to have them used and used well.

The binding is scrappy with lengths of some of the blocks fabrics, and some of the leftover strips from cutting the borders of the pale grey and charcoal. I quite like the effect of pops of colour along the outer edge of the quilt.
